Wireless Emergency Alerts (WEAs) are short emergency messages from authorized federal, state, local, tribal and territorial public alerting authorities that can be broadcast from cell towers to any WEAenabled mobile device in a locally targeted area. Site Area Emergency (SAE) Events are in progress or have occurred which have caused (or likely will cause) major failures of plant functions that protect the public, or involve security events with intentional damage or malicious acts that could lead to the likely failure of (or prevent effective access to) equipment needed to protect the public. Code Silver alerts hospital staff to a person with a weapon and/or active shooter and/or hostage situation. Code Red, Code Blue, and Code Pink were all determined to be universal alerts and may continue to be used as an alternative to the use of plain language for fire, cardiac/respiratory arrest and missing infant/child respectively.
